## Summary

The University of Newcastle upon Tyne is currently conducting a tender for the sale of land aimed at facilitating development, construction, and the sale of homes on the Helix Residential Site, located in Newcastle upon Tyne. This project is at the tender stage, with submissions due by 18th February 2021. The procurement follows a restricted procedure and has an estimated value of £5,000,000, with a minimum land receipt requirement set by the contracting authority. This initiative is part of a larger, ambitious programme to regenerate a 24-acre site previously used for coal mining and brewing, which aims to deliver a total of 440 residential units. The contract period is expected to commence from 4th June 2021 and extend until 31st May 2029.

## Notice

The University is letting this contract on behalf of Newcastle Science Central Management LLP. The scope is for the sale of the land (through a procurement regulation compliant restricted procedure) to a Contractor with the relevant experience, capability and resources to invest in and deliver development, construction, and sale of homes to final occupation on the Helix Residential Site in accordance with the LLP's objectives and requirements. Newcastle Helix (formerly known as Science Central) is a site of national and international significance. Regeneration of a prime City Centre site at this scale is a once in a generation opportunity. The LLP's vision is big. A 24-acre quarter in the centre of Newcastle upon Tyne. A PS350M programme of residential, commercial and academic capital development on a site previously used for coal mining and brewing. The LLP's vision is clear: To help everybody live easier, healthier, longer and smarter lives. Now and in the future. There is 6 residential plots for development to bring forward the new community for the site, comprising plots 12 through to 17 and representing approximately 5.5 acres of the overall site. There is a Homes England requirement to achieve a minimum of 440 residential units on the site. A planning consent for 66 units, which would contribute to the requirement has been secured by Karbon Homes in respect of plot 7 (not included in this opportunity). The LLP expects the highest standard of housing to come forward, taking inspiration from places like the Sterling Prize winning Goldsmith Street in Norwich. A minimum land receipt of PS5,000,000 (five million pounds sterling) must be paid to the LLP.
